1. A compound used in fluoroscopy to obtain images of internal organs in the human body contains

1.67g of cerium, Ce, and 4.54g of iodine, I. What is the empirical formula of this compound?

2. Methylpropene is used in the production of synthetic rubber. Calculate the empirical formula of this

compound that contains 0.556g of carbon, C, and 0.0933g of hydrogen, H.

3. Benzoic acid is a compound used as a food preservative. It contains 68.8%C, 4.95%H, and 26.2%O by mass.

What is the empirical formula of this compound?

4. Freon is a gaseous compound used in refrigeration and air conditioning systems. It contains 9.93% carbon, 58.6% chlorine, and 31.4% fluorine by mass. Find

the empirical formula of Freon?

5. Dichloroacetic acid is corrosive to the skin and has been used to remove blemishes. What is the molecular formula of dichloroacetic acid, if the empirical formula is CHOCl

and the molecular mass is 129 amu?

6. What is the molecular formula of cyanuric chloride, a compound used in the production of some dyes, if the empirical formula

if CClN and the molecular mass is 184.5 amu.

7. Ascorbic acid, also known as vitamin C, has a percentage composition of 40.9% carbon, 4.58% hydrogen, and 54.5%

oxygen. What is the molecular formula of ascorbic acid given that it has a molecular mass of 176.1 amu?

8. Aspirin contains 60.0% carbon, 4.48% hydrogen, and 35.5% oxygen. It has a molecular mass of 180.0 amu.

What is the molecular formula of aspirin?
